dns outages cause widespread disruption

DNS may be small, but its failure can shut down entire systems, causing widespread outages and costly disruptions. When misconfigurations, cyberattacks, or hardware failures happen, they can block access to websites, services, and applications for millions. Centralized DNS setups are especially vulnerable, making resilience essential. To avoid costly downtime, organizations must build secure, distributed, and monitored DNS systems. Keep exploring to discover how you can protect your digital infrastructure from these tiny yet powerful vulnerabilities.

Key Takeaways

  • DNS failures can cause widespread internet outages, disrupting essential services and affecting millions globally.
  • Small misconfigurations or human errors in DNS settings often trigger large-scale system failures.
  • Attack vectors like DDoS and cache poisoning exploit DNS vulnerabilities, leading to system downtime.
  • Implementing DNSSEC, multi-provider setups, and registry locks enhances resilience against failures.
  • Rapid incident response and continuous monitoring are critical to minimizing DNS failure impacts.

The Critical Role of DNS in Modern Infrastructure

dns ensures internet connectivity

DNS is the backbone of modern internet infrastructure, translating human-readable domain names into machine-readable IP addresses that enable seamless online communication. Without DNS, you’d need to remember complex IP addresses for every website you visit, making browsing cumbersome. When you type a URL, DNS resolves it quickly, directing your request to the correct server. This process happens in milliseconds, supporting everything from accessing websites to sending emails and streaming content. Because DNS is so integral, any failure can disrupt vast portions of the internet, affecting millions of users and countless services. Its efficiency and reliability are what keep the digital world running smoothly. Yet, this critical role also makes DNS a prime target for attacks and failures that can cause widespread outages. High-performance DNS servers are essential to ensure rapid resolution times and minimize downtime, especially during peak usage periods. Ensuring the security and robustness of DNS systems is vital to prevent systemic failures that could cascade into larger network issues. Additionally, implementing redundant DNS infrastructure can help mitigate risks associated with server outages and enhance overall resilience. Moreover, adopting robust security protocols is crucial to defend against DNS-specific threats like cache poisoning and DDoS attacks, further safeguarding the infrastructure. Incorporating automated monitoring tools can also help identify issues early, maintaining the integrity of DNS services.

Common Causes Behind DNS Outages and Failures

dns misconfigurations and human errors

Many outages originate from misconfigurations, human errors, and software bugs that disrupt the delicate processes of domain resolution. Registry mistakes, such as incorrect server configurations or permission changes, can cause entire domains to go offline temporarily. Human errors during DNS setup or updates—like accidentally deleting records or misplacing delegation entries—often trigger widespread failures. Software bugs in resolvers, control planes, or automation tools may produce incorrect answers or block access, propagating errors globally. Inadequate change controls and absent registry locks increase the risk of malicious or accidental alterations. Relying on a single provider or region creates a chokepoint, making localized errors escalate into large-scale outages. These systemic issues highlight how small missteps or flaws can cascade into major disruptions across internet infrastructure. Additionally, faulty hardware or network equipment, such as switches or routers, can introduce errors that affect DNS availability and performance. Ensuring robust network redundancy and proactive monitoring can help mitigate some of these risks.

How DNS Attacks Exploit Systemic Vulnerabilities

protect dns from systemic vulnerabilities

You should be aware that attackers target systemic weaknesses like centralized dependencies and misconfigurations to cause widespread DNS failures. They exploit attack vectors such as cache poisoning, DDoS, and malware channels to manipulate or disrupt DNS services. By understanding these vulnerabilities, you can better defend against attacks that leverage systemic flaws to maximize impact. Recognizing the importance of appliance maintenance plans can help prevent hardware failures that might contribute to system vulnerabilities. Additionally, implementing system redundancy can mitigate the effects of targeted attacks on DNS infrastructure, ensuring continued service availability. Incorporating security best practices can further strengthen defenses against these systemic threats. Regularly reviewing and updating network security protocols is essential to adapt to evolving attack techniques and protect DNS systems from emerging vulnerabilities. Being aware of systemic dependencies allows organizations to identify critical points of failure and develop comprehensive mitigation strategies.

Systemic Dependency Risks

Systemic dependency vulnerabilities arise when organizations rely heavily on centralized or poorly distributed DNS infrastructure, creating critical points of failure that attackers can target. Such reliance means a single misconfiguration or attack can cascade across multiple services. To manage this risk, you should:

  1. Use multi-provider DNS setups and geographically dispersed authoritative servers to prevent region-specific failures.
  2. Enforce strict registry locks and MFA on registrar accounts to avoid malicious or accidental changes.
  3. Implement DNSSEC to guard against cache poisoning and forgery.
  4. Monitor DNS traffic continuously with threat detection tools to identify abuse early.
  5. Maintaining redundant DNS infrastructure ensures continuous service availability even if one provider or region experiences issues. Additionally, adopting distributed DNS architectures can further reduce systemic risks by spreading authority across multiple, independent nodes. Incorporating diversified DNS providers minimizes the impact of provider-specific outages and enhances overall resilience. Regularly testing your DNS failover procedures and disaster recovery plans can help ensure quick response during outages. A failure to diversify DNS sources increases the risk of widespread outages, impacting millions and risking your organization’s reputation and revenue.

Attack Vectors Exploited

Attack vectors exploit existing vulnerabilities in DNS infrastructure by targeting its systemic weaknesses. You might face DNS cache poisoning or spoofing, redirecting traffic to malicious sites or stealing credentials. DDoS attacks overwhelm resolvers and authoritative servers, causing widespread outages. Cybercriminals use DNS as a covert channel to distribute malware or exfiltrate data, exploiting insecure configurations. Human errors, like misconfigured registries or accidental server blocks, open doors for attacks or outages. Software bugs in DNS resolvers or control systems can produce incorrect answers, leading to service disruptions. Overreliance on single-region control planes amplifies risks from localized failures. Attackers often manipulate DNS records through vulnerabilities in registries or registrar accounts, especially when lacking strong security measures. These systemic flaws make DNS an attractive target for malicious exploits, threatening entire systems.

The Economic Impact of DNS Disruptions on Businesses

dns disruptions cause financial loss

DNS disruptions can cause significant financial losses for businesses by rendering their online services unreachable and disrupting customer access. When customers can’t find or reach your website, you lose sales, damage brand trust, and face increased support costs. The economic impact can be severe:

  1. Revenue Loss: Extended outages mean missed transactions and sales opportunities.
  2. Reputational Damage: Customers lose confidence, leading to long-term brand harm.
  3. Operational Costs: Incident response, recovery efforts, and legal liabilities spike during disruptions. Additionally, the reliance on systemic infrastructure underscores how vulnerable these core components are to failure, amplifying the economic risks involved.
  4. Market Competitiveness: Frequent DNS failures can push customers to competitors, eroding market share. The reliability of DNS systems is crucial for maintaining trust and operational continuity in today’s digital economy. Recognizing the importance of core network components highlights how even tiny failures can cascade into large-scale outages that threaten business stability.

These costs quickly add up, with industry estimates averaging nearly $950,000 per incident globally. In today’s digital economy, a DNS failure isn’t just a technical glitch—it’s a direct hit to your bottom line. Existential themes in technology highlight how critical reliable systems are for maintaining trust and operational continuity.

Strategies for Building Resilient DNS Architectures

implement layered dns redundancy

Building a resilient DNS architecture requires proactive planning and implementation of multiple layers of redundancy. You should deploy authoritative nameservers across diverse geographic regions and use multiple providers to avoid single points of failure. Enforce strict registry locks, enable multi-factor authentication on registrar accounts, and limit administrative privileges to prevent accidental or malicious changes. Implement DNSSEC to safeguard against record forgery and cache poisoning, but ensure proper setup and ongoing monitoring. Use managed recursive resolvers with security policies to detect abuse early. Harden your DNS control plane by applying change controls, validation, staging, and rollback procedures. Design for graceful degradation by caching essential records with appropriate TTLs and maintaining out-of-band access. Regularly exercise failover scenarios and coordinate with upstream providers to guarantee swift recovery during incidents. Additionally, staying informed about domain name system standards helps ensure your architecture adheres to best practices and remains resilient against evolving threats. Incorporating monitoring tools can further enhance your ability to detect and respond to issues promptly. To further strengthen resilience, consider implementing automated alerting that promptly notifies administrators of anomalies or failures in DNS services. Furthermore, keeping abreast of emerging security threats allows for timely updates and defenses to protect your DNS infrastructure effectively. Regular education and training on DNS management best practices are essential for maintaining a resilient and secure DNS environment.

Best Practices for Securing and Managing DNS Zones

secure dns zone management

Securing and managing DNS zones effectively requires implementing robust controls to prevent unauthorized access and accidental modifications. Start by enforcing strict registrar account protections, such as multi-factor authentication and limited privileges. Next, use registry locks on critical zones to prevent unauthorized registry changes. Deploy DNSSEC to authenticate DNS records and prevent cache poisoning. Finally, establish holistic change management processes with automated validation, staging, and rollback capabilities. This includes maintaining detailed audit logs and conducting regular reviews. These practices reduce human error, mitigate malicious registry actions, and bolster zone integrity. By applying these controls, you safeguard your DNS infrastructure from misconfigurations and attacks, ensuring consistent resolution and minimizing the risk of widespread outages.

rapid dns crisis management

When a DNS-related crisis occurs, swift and effective incident response is critical to minimizing downtime and preventing further damage. Start by activating your predefined runbook, which should include contact info for registries, registrars, and DNS providers. Quickly identify the scope by analyzing logs, telemetry, and outage signals to determine if the issue stems from misconfigurations, cache poisoning, or external attacks. Implement immediate workarounds, such as switching to cached IPs with controlled TTLs or using alternative DNS resolvers. Communicate clearly with stakeholders and affected users, providing updates and expected resolution times. Coordinate with upstream providers and security teams to isolate the root cause. After recovery, conduct a thorough post-incident review, document lessons learned, and refine your response plan to better handle future crises.

Leveraging Monitoring and Telemetry for Early Detection

monitor dns for anomalies

You should set up continuous telemetry collection to monitor DNS activity and detect unusual patterns early. Applying anomaly detection techniques helps you identify potential issues like cache poisoning or DDoS attacks before they escalate. When you respond rapidly to these signals, you minimize downtime and prevent widespread service disruptions.

Continuous Telemetry Collection

Continuous telemetry collection plays a crucial role in early detection of DNS anomalies and potential threats. By actively monitoring DNS traffic and system metrics, you can identify issues before they escalate. Focus on these key areas:

  1. Track DNS query patterns to spot unusual spikes or drops that signal malicious activity or misconfigurations.
  2. Collect resolver and authoritative server logs to detect anomalies like cache poisoning or spoofing attempts.
  3. Monitor DNS response times and error rates to identify latency issues or failures.
  4. Use telemetry data to observe changes in domain resolution behavior, enabling swift detection of hijacking or tampering.

Implementing continuous telemetry ensures you have real-time insights, helping you respond proactively and minimize the impact of DNS failures.

Anomaly Detection Techniques

Effective anomaly detection in DNS relies on leveraging monitoring and telemetry data to identify deviations from normal behavior promptly. You should deploy real-time analytics tools that track DNS query patterns, response times, and error rates across your infrastructure. Look for sudden spikes in failed lookups, increased latency, or unusual query volumes, which can signal malicious activity or misconfigurations. Implement dashboards that visualize traffic anomalies, enabling quick identification of irregularities. Use threshold-based alerts to notify your team of potential issues early. Combining passive monitoring with active probing helps distinguish benign anomalies from genuine threats. Regularly review logs, telemetry feeds, and network flow data to detect subtle signs of compromise or failures. This proactive approach helps prevent minor issues from cascading into widespread DNS outages.

Rapid Incident Response

How can organizations detect DNS incidents early enough to mitigate damage before they escalate? By leveraging monitoring and telemetry, you can identify issues swiftly. Here’s how:

  1. Implement real-time DNS logs and analytics to spot anomalies like sudden spikes in query volume or unusual record changes.
  2. Use threat detection tools that flag suspicious patterns such as cache poisoning signs or DNS tunneling activities.
  3. Set up alerts for failed lookups or resolver errors that could indicate misconfigurations or attacks.
  4. Regularly analyze resolver and authoritative server telemetry to identify early signs of tampering or ongoing attacks.

Proactive monitoring enables rapid response, reducing downtime and limiting the impact of DNS failures. Timely detection is critical to maintaining system resilience and trust.

The Future of DNS Security and Reliability

enhance dns security resilience

As the reliance on DNS continues to grow, future security and reliability depend on innovative strategies that address current vulnerabilities and emerging threats. You’ll need to adopt multi-layered defenses like DNSSEC, which helps prevent cache poisoning and record forgery. Enforcing strict registry locks and multi-factor authentication minimizes the risk of malicious or accidental registry changes. You should also implement geographically distributed authoritative servers and multi-provider architectures to reduce single points of failure. Continuous monitoring, threat detection, and real-time telemetry are essential for early abuse detection. Additionally, designing fallback mechanisms guarantees service continuity during DNS outages. Regular incident simulations and detailed recovery plans will prepare you for potential failures. Together, these measures will strengthen DNS resilience, safeguarding your systems against evolving risks.

Case Studies of Major DNS Failures and Lessons Learned

major dns failure lessons

You need to understand how major DNS failures happen by examining real-world examples. These incidents reveal common causes like misconfigurations, human errors, and software bugs, often with widespread consequences. Learning from these cases helps you identify key lessons to improve your DNS resilience and prevent similar outages.

Notable Outage Examples

Major DNS outages have repeatedly demonstrated how a single failure can cascade into widespread service disruptions, affecting millions of users and thousands of organizations. These incidents highlight the critical importance of DNS resilience. For example:

  1. In 2016, a misconfigured Amazon Route 53 DNS record caused Amazon Web Services outages, impacting numerous clients.
  2. The 2017 Dyn DDoS attack used DNS-based DDoS to bring down major sites like Twitter and Netflix.
  3. In 2019, a registry error at Register.com inadvertently took thousands of domains offline temporarily.
  4. The 2020 Google Cloud DNS failure disrupted services across multiple regions, emphasizing dependency risks. These examples teach that even minor misconfigurations or attacks can cause massive fallout, underscoring the need for robust redundancy and careful management.

Key Lessons Learned

Examining past DNS failures reveals valuable insights into how even small mistakes can escalate into widespread outages. You learn that misconfigurations, human errors, or software bugs often trigger major disruptions, emphasizing the need for strict controls and validation processes. Implementing multi-provider architectures and geographically distributed nameservers reduces single points of failure. Enforcing registry locks and using DNSSEC helps prevent cache poisoning and unauthorized changes. Regularly monitoring DNS traffic and employing automated validation catch abuse early, minimizing damage. Designing services to degrade gracefully—such as caching IPs and maintaining out-of-band access—keeps critical functions operational during outages. Clearly documented incident response plans, including registrar contacts and recovery procedures, accelerate recovery. By sharing lessons and exercising failure scenarios, you can strengthen resilience and reduce the risk of future DNS failures.

Frequently Asked Questions

How Can Organizations Detect Early Signs of DNS Poisoning or Tampering?

You can detect early signs of DNS poisoning or tampering by monitoring DNS traffic for anomalies, such as unexpected redirects or inconsistent responses. Implement DNSSEC validation to verify record authenticity and use threat detection tools that flag suspicious activity. Regularly analyze logs and telemetry for signs of cache poisoning, like altered records or unusual query patterns. Staying vigilant and adopting continuous monitoring helps catch tampering before it escalates.

What Are the Most Effective Methods to Prevent Registry-Level Misconfigurations?

Prevent registry-level misconfigurations by implementing rigorous registration routines, restricting access, and reinforcing robust, regular reviews. Use registry locks, multi-factor authentication, and meticulous monitoring to minimize mistakes. Maintain meticulous, multi-layered change controls, and mandate manual audits before alterations. Foster fast, flexible response plans for faults, and stay synchronized with trusted providers. Strengthen security strategies by securing settings, safeguarding systems, and staying vigilant against vulnerabilities, ensuring your domains don’t drift into disaster.

How Does DNSSEC Deployment Impact Operational Reliability and Security?

Deploying DNSSEC boosts both operational reliability and security by authenticating DNS responses and preventing cache poisoning. It guarantees users receive verified data, reducing malicious redirection risks. However, DNSSEC requires careful implementation, ongoing monitoring, and correct key management; misconfigurations can cause outages. You should balance its security benefits with operational complexity, employing proper validation, automation, and staff training to maximize resilience while defending against DNS-based threats.

What Are Practical Steps for Implementing Multi-Provider DNS Architectures?

You should start by selecting multiple reputable DNS providers with diverse geographic presence. Configure each provider independently, avoiding shared dependencies. Use automated tools for seamless updates and synchronization across all providers. Implement monitoring to detect issues early, and test failover processes regularly. Enforce strict security measures like DNSSEC and registrar locks. Document procedures for quick recovery, and coordinate with providers for coordinated incident response, ensuring resilience against outages or attacks.

How Can Businesses Develop Effective Incident Response Plans for DNS Outages?

Imagine you’re in the cockpit during a storm—your incident response plan guides every move. To develop an effective DNS outage plan, you should create clear procedures for quick escalation, maintain detailed contact info for registrars and providers, and include fallback options like cached IPs. Regularly test these plans through simulations, keep logs for root cause analysis, and coordinate with upstream providers to stay ahead of emerging threats.

Conclusion

Remember, DNS is the backbone of your digital world—if it falters, everything grinds to a halt. By understanding its vulnerabilities and implementing resilient strategies, you can turn this tiny component from a ticking time bomb into a fortress. Don’t wait for a failure to realize its importance; stay proactive. Think of DNS as the nervous system of your network—keep it healthy, or risk losing control when you need it most.

You May Also Like

Latency Vs Bandwidth: the Cloud Performance Confusion

Bandwidth and latency differences impact cloud performance; understanding which one matters most can significantly improve your setup—discover how inside.

CDN Basics for EU Sites: Performance Without Breaking Compliance

Aiming to optimize EU site performance while ensuring compliance? Discover essential CDN strategies to balance speed and privacy effectively.

Private Connectivity Vs VPN: When Each One Actually Makes Sense

More than just security, understanding when private connectivity or VPN makes sense can transform your approach to protecting data—discover which solution fits your needs.

Cross-Region Traffic: Why It’s Expensive and How to Reduce It

Understanding cross-region traffic costs can save your cloud budget—discover strategies to reduce these expenses and optimize your architecture.